الوصف

In a world scarred by war and looming darkness, the story unfolds around a unique protagonist who struggles with both his human nature and his supernatural abilities. Set against the backdrop of World War II, this tale intertwines history with horror, merging the brutal realities of conflict with the chilling presence of the supernatural. The protagonist, caught between two worlds, navigates his dual identity with a sense of purpose and urgency.

Drawing readers into a labyrinth of intrigue, the narrative explores themes of loyalty, sacrifice, and the struggle for redemption. Each chapter reveals the complexities of human emotion layered within the chaos of war, while maintaining an undercurrent of suspense and tension. The protagonist's journey is marked by unforgettable encounters and chilling adversaries, urging him to confront not just external threats, but the darker aspects of his own existence.

As the plot thickens, alliances are tested, and betrayals become inevitable. The storytelling boasts vivid imagery and richly developed characters, making each moment resonant and poignant. McCammon's deft handling of the supernatural elements enhances the narrative, prompting readers to question what it means to be both beast and man in a world that often blurs the lines between good and evil.

With expertly crafted prose and a gripping narrative arc, this work stands as a testament to the resilience of the human spirit even in the face of unimaginable horror. It invites readers to explore the depths of courage, the weight of destiny, and the eternal battle between darkness and light.
